What is recorded here

According to local information this natural rock outcrop served as a mass rock for the local people during penal times (pers. comm. Marie Seery, 01/05/2019). A crucifixion slab of post-1700 date which was used as a window sill in the adjoining cottage ruins to SW was taken from this building and is now kept in nearby Coolvuck House. It is possible that the cottage to the SW of the mass rock was the residence of an R. C. priest during penal times. Compiled by: Caimin O'Brien Date of upload: 02 May 2019
A mass-rock used for clandestine Catholic worship during the Penal Times; associated with the crucifixion slab found at the site, reflecting the persecution and resilience of the local Catholic community.
